| Michael Lewis and Cameron White Mick Lewis is an opening bowler from Victoria. He's decievingly quick and quite accurate and was also the bowler that hit Langer in the ribs recently. Cameron White is the Victorian captain and leggie. His leggies are pretty ordinary, doesnt spin the ball much and is not that accurate. His strength is probably his lower order hitting, where he is quite dangerous.
